MOSCOW (Pakistan Point News / Sputnik - 08th May, 2019) INSTEX, the EU mechanism for bilateral transactions with Iran bypassing US sanctions, is not working as effectively as planned, which makes Moscow back Iran's demand to include a provision on oil exports in the document, Russian Foreign Minister Sergey Lavrov said after talks with Iranian counterpart Mohammad Javad Zarif.

"As far as I understand, [the INSTEX mechanism] is much less effective and comprehensive than planned. It is important for Iran to have this mechanism permit oil exports. We support this absolutely legitimate requirement, which is enshrined in the JCPOA," Lavrov said.
